php bb forum

php bb forum - PHP - Programmation

Marsh Posté le 02-08-2004 à 17:41:00    

Salut,
j'ai installé ce forum (http://www.phpbb.com) sur mon site, tout marchait depuis environ un an ou deux et là ça fait une semaine qu'il met:  

phpBB : Critical Error  
 
Error creating new session


 
Vous savez d'où ça peut venir?
merci


Message édité par kameha le 02-08-2004 à 17:41:22
Reply

Marsh Posté le 02-08-2004 à 17:41:00   

Reply

Marsh Posté le 02-08-2004 à 17:41:43    

ça vient de mon hébergeur?

Reply

Marsh Posté le 03-08-2004 à 10:51:55    

Désolé, j'ai jamais utilisé php BB, je ne connais pas son fonctionnement. Tu as regardé le répertoire dans lequel sont crées les sessions ? peut-être qu'elle ne sont pas supprimées...
 
enfin ça m'étonnerai quand meme

Reply

Marsh Posté le 03-08-2004 à 13:15:28    

c'est qui ton hébergeur

Reply

Marsh Posté le 09-08-2004 à 10:21:10    

après recherche, il semblerait qu'il faut vider ma table session.
 
Vous savez comment on fait? on peut passer par ftp en modifiant une page php?

Reply

Marsh Posté le 09-08-2004 à 10:54:35    

pour vider la table session fo se connecter sur le server mysql
 
donc soit phpmyadmin qui doit etre proposé par tion hebergeur, soit acces console mais je doute que ce type d'acces soit proposé en hebergement

Reply

Marsh Posté le 09-08-2004 à 11:00:26    

si tu as installer bb tu dois avoir un prefixe pour ta base ainsi que le nom du compte et le password.
Tu unpload une page qui se connecte a la base avec ce login et password puis tu balance une requete DELETE FROM prefixe_sessions car la tables des sessions se nommes "sessions" dans phpBB


Message édité par Rainbow_Efreet le 09-08-2004 à 11:01:21
Reply

Marsh Posté le 09-08-2004 à 12:03:47    

oulah, chaud ton truc.
qu'est ce qu'un prefixe?
Il faut que j'upload une page de mon forum depuis mon herbergeur? genre connect.php?
J'ai trouvé dans includes--> une page nommé sessions.php.
jpeux pas travailler dessus?

Reply

Marsh Posté le 09-08-2004 à 16:05:06    

euh les questions sur phpBB sont à poser dans Software & Réseaux :o


---------------
Whichever format the fan may want to listen is fine with us – vinyl, wax cylinders, shellac, 8-track, iPod, cloud storage, cranial implants – just as long as it’s loud and rockin' (Billy Gibbons, ZZ Top)
Reply

Marsh Posté le 10-08-2004 à 00:46:09    

vide la table sessions

Reply

Marsh Posté le 10-08-2004 à 00:46:09   

Reply

Marsh Posté le 10-08-2004 à 08:50:02    

Dabourn a écrit :

vide la table sessions


c bien , on voit que t as bien lu les posts precedents........

Reply

Marsh Posté le 10-08-2004 à 10:14:41    

en telechargeant phpmyadmin(http://www.phpmyadmin.net/home_page/)
, avec la DNS, le nom d'utilisateur, le mot de passe et le nom de la base, je devrais pouvoir m'en sortir nan?
Parceque ceux qui s'occupe de mon hebergement sont en vacances et je n'ai pas la possibilité d'avoir une adresse url qui m'enverrai directement sur la base.

Reply

Marsh Posté le 10-08-2004 à 11:01:22    

en theorie ton hebergeur te fournit phpmyadmin, ce n'est aps a toi de l'installer...
tu es heberge ou ?
Regarde dans les doc de ton hebergeur s'il n'y pas par hasard les liens de connection via phpmyadmin

Reply

Marsh Posté le 10-08-2004 à 11:14:46    

chez "Astrolab".
Sur la doc j'ai:
- DNS à utiliser (mysql12342.vs.netbenefit.co.uk)
- Nom d'utilisateur
- Mot de passe
- Nom de la base
 

Reply

Marsh Posté le 10-08-2004 à 11:39:47    

arf....
tu peux essayer d'installer phpmyadmin sur ton espace site, mais je ne c pas si cela va fonctionner.
sinon effectivement, si tu connais le nom des tables tu peux faire un script php qui va supprimer les entrées de la table session....ce serait plus simple mais il faut connaitre le nom des tables....
 

Reply

Marsh Posté le 10-08-2004 à 11:54:02    

donc, je prends index.php de mon forum.
Là j'insere une ligne genre:
<?php DELETE FROM prefixe_sessions ?>
j'l'upload et ça devrait marcher
?

Reply

Marsh Posté le 10-08-2004 à 11:54:30    

prefixe c'est le nom de la base?

Reply

Marsh Posté le 10-08-2004 à 13:39:06    

non ca ne marches pas comme ca,  
1°) je ne connais pas le prefixe, je n'ai jamais installé PHPBB
2°) il faut utiliser les fonctions mysql pour excecuter la requete

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ed